CENTRAL YUKON, ALASKA
A wildfire reported by zone aircraft 9VS (BLM) was spotted as a new fire on June 3rd on Red Mountain, caused by lightning.
The fire has burned 52 acres of black spruce and brush. There is a 60% containment status gained by ground fire personnel, however 40% is still actively burning that includes the perimeter.
J-07, ASM B-5 and Firebosses 241 and 243 responded from Fairbanks, while J-07 deployed eight smokejumbers who began fire suppression efforts that are due to continue throughout the evening.
No assets in the area are currently under threat.
